Further development of the echo sounder

We offer echosounders of all leading manufacturers: from Garmin to Johnson Outdoors with Humminbird, Navico with its well-known brands Lowrance and Simrad as well as Raymarine with its innovative products. New developments such as the patented Side Imaging process, the breathtaking 3D technology deliver breathtaking or photorealistic images of the underwater world. From another perspective, Down Imaging shows you exactly what's going on under your boat. Digital sonar takes our traditional sonar technology to a new level. Chirp (chirping) in signal processing means a signal whose frequency changes over time. In nature, bats use these for locating. In the echo sounder range, the conventional transmitter has so far only ever transmitted one frequency one after the other and compiled a picture from the returning echoes. With CHIRP, the encoder simultaneously emits several different frequencies and analyzes the returning echoes of the different frequencies. Because higher frequencies allow more sensitive echoes and smaller frequencies penetrate deeper, the CHIRP Sonar builds very detailed images, not photorealistic but close to it. CHIRP stands for Compressed High-Intensity Radiated Pulse. Raymarine launched this technique in 2014 for the first time in the fishing industry for echo sounders. In 2016, the 3D technology, first at Garmin, then Lowrance and Raymarine has arrived. From the boat to the bottom of the ground you can see a larger area in 3D and thus know where and at what depth fish are. For the first time, the Raymarine Axiom 3D offers a unique encoder for all functions. The new live transducers named Garmin Panoptix LiveScope, Lowrance Active Target and Humminbird Mega Live Imaging allow the underwater view in real time.
